Ceramic burning smell will not dissipate after several days of continuous use...a known problem by the manufacturer. Cord also has issues as it gets very hot and is likely not rated for 1500 watts. Returning it ASAP. Essentially, they make crap and then expect consumers to smell it every day of use. Their Customer service department has said that it is a common problem with ceramic heaters of this kind and is therefore not a defect. I totally disagree because I have two other ceramic space heaters (Vornado) that have never had this awful smell issue. They sent me a new in box replacement unit under warranty that had the EXACT same problem...they didn't even bother to test it before shipping it out. Now they want the replacement unit back to "investigate" the problem, which they have already said is a common issue. They said they would need the unit for 3-4 weeks and by that time winter will be over!

We have another heater of this brand which is several years old and still working. Hopefully this one will last as long.The only issue I notice is that the thermostat swing is kind of high. What this means is that if you set it on 68F then it will heat until it reaches 72F before shutting off. This might be necessary because it could be in a larger room than I’m using it in, and it can’t accurately measure the room temperature when it’s heating. It’s probably a limitation of this kind of heater that doesn’t have a remote temperature sensor.The oscillation arc (range of back and forth motion) is also pretty narrow but that doesn’t really matter to me for what we use it for. If for some reason you want a wide range of oscillation, like 45-90degrees, this is not the heater you want because the range only seems to be 15 degrees or something.
